Bob Smith terminals, also known as Bob Smith terminal networks, are a technology used in Ethernet ports. This technology improves the performance of Ethernet interfaces by using resistors and capacitors to provide common-mode impedance matching. This helps reduce electromagnetic interference (EMI) and improves signal integrity. The "Bob Smith" technique uses a 75 Ohm resistor for a common mode impedance match at each signal pair, collectively connected via a 1000pF capacitor to the chassis ground. The resistors are typically placed in series with each differential signal line, and the capacitor is used for common-mode noise filtering. The purpose of this termination technique is to match the common-mode impedance of the transmission line, which helps minimize reflections and maintain signal integrity.
